The STM32G030F6P6 is a microcontroller from the STM32G0 series, developed by STMicroelectronics. It is based on the ARM Cortex-M0+ 32-bit RISC core and offers a wide range of features and peripherals suitable for various embedded applications.
Here are some key features of the STM32G030F6P6:
1. Microcontroller Core: It is based on the ARM Cortex-M0+ 32-bit RISC core running at a maximum frequency of 64 MHz. The Cortex-M0+ core provides excellent performance and energy efficiency.
2. Flash Memory: It has 32 KB of flash memory for storing program code and application data.
3. RAM: It features 8 KB of SRAM (static random-access memory) for data storage and processing.
4. Peripherals: The STM32G030F6P6 includes a variety of peripherals, including UARTs (USARTs), SPI interfaces, I2C interfaces, timers, ADCs (analog-to-digital converters), DACs (digital-to-analog converters), PWM (pulse-width modulation) controllers, and more.
5. Connectivity: It supports various communication protocols such as UART, SPI, and I2C for interfacing with other devices.
6. Operating Voltage: It operates at a voltage range of 2.0V to 3.6V, making it compatible with different power supply configurations.
7. Package Type: The "P6" in the part number indicates the package type, which in this case is a 20-pin TSSOP (Thin Shrink Small Outline Package).
The STM32G030F6P6 is widely used in various applications such as home appliances, industrial automation, consumer electronics, and smart devices. It offers a combination of performance, peripherals, and low-power capabilities that make it suitable for a wide range of embedded system designs.
For more detailed information about the STM32G030F6P6, I recommend referring to the datasheet and reference manual provided by STMicroelectronics. These documents provide comprehensive information on the electrical specifications, pin assignments, programming, and usage guidelines for the microcontroller.